KEPCO Q2: Analysts Saw the Cut Coming — Just Not Half of It
KEPCO’s Q2 operating profit came in 42.5% below consensus. The gap has a name: coal rose 24% while the government kept the electricity tariff frozen.

Korean Q2 earnings season is seven trading days long. Of the 60 companies that disclosed an IR schedule to the Korea Exchange, 58 report between August 6 and August 14 – the semi-annual filing deadline, 45 days after the half-year end. Fourteen report on August 12 alone. Samsung and SK Hynix already went in July. KEPCO still has no date.
